The main highlight of this tour will be a visit to EL-DL House - the NS Documentation Center. Entrance tickets are included. The EL-DL House is the former headquarters of the Gestapo (secret police) turned into a virtual "place of terror". The basements of the house had been used as prison cells and torture rooms for forced laborers and political enemies. Over 1800 inscriptions made on the walls by the prisoners can still be viewed today. The upper floors with Gestapo offices represent administrative terror and an evil system created by Nazis.
